Hi, I am located 500meters from the nearest elecric supply post and would like to get connected. The idea is to hook up 20 homes to mains supply.

Is there anyone out there who may know the costs involved in this operation on the north of Phuket, Many Thanks.

500 meters high voltage 3phase was 5 years ago more than one million baht in Kata.

Trafo depending on size, 50-300k. Then 220/380 volt one phase/3 phase 4 wires depending on distance, size and poles or underground.

you need a quote from your local PEA after you have calculated your demand, distances and poles or underground

edit sorry forgot to ask if your nearest supply is high voltage or not. 500 meters low voltage PEA wont do for 20 houses
